Output 64360a0dc40e648a0108bbd2dd18cd3c35156cde719056f276546d08523fceae:62

value
590836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7369bb69b8e272e4b7b3f68a8964d0e1d4278c88 OP_EQUAL
address
3CDGHzqrEudpweteqRkQHZkzQMP3bAHWNU
transaction
64360a0dc40e648a0108bbd2dd18cd3c35156cde719056f276546d08523fceae
confirmations
146352
spent
true